  • Patent number: 5333243
    Abstract: The invention is for use with a visible medium capable of light reflection etc., and for use with a color-image source that defines a desired color. Here a device for causing the medium to appear colored includes a gray-scale subsystem to achromatically suppress a stated fraction of the reflection; and at least two device-primary subsystems to cause selective reflection of light of two associated device-primary colors. Even if the device, as originally made, in effect uses the gray-scale subsystem to help construct colors, or the device-primary subsystems to help form gray-scale "values", such cross-dependency is essentially removed. A programmed processor resolves the desired-rendition information into Fraction-Black, Fraction-Colorant, and hue.

  • Patent number: 4916638
    Abstract: A media advance system for swath-type printers for precisely positioning the media for successive swath printing. A dual photodiode line sensor is mounted on the print head. The diode active areas are separated by less than the line widths of lines printed in the media margin. Circuitry is provided to provide a signal indicative of the difference between the photocurrents produced by each photodiode. For the first swath of the page or plot, marginal lines are drawn by the first and Nth print device of the print head. Without moving the media, the line sensor is positioned over the marginal line printed by the first device, and the resulting difference signal is saved as a reference value. The media is then advanced until the same value of the difference signal is obtained from the line image of the marginal line drawn by the Nth print device. The media is then advanced a predetermined amount to precisely position the media for the next successive swath to be printed.
